Job Title: Sr Mgr, Power Plant
Work Place Flexibility: Onsite
Legal Entity: Entergy Louisiana, LLC
Manages and oversees the operations of a power plants. Responsible for operations reliability, safety, compliance, and financial performance. Ensures plant is prepared to meet system load requirements and proactively monitors operations for efficiency and safety ensuring that all applicable regulatory requirements are followed. Leads and directs the work of others. Oversees technical staff, such as maintenance, engineering, work management/planning, and administrative support. Hires, trains/develops personnel. Relies on extensive experience and judgment to plan and accomplish goals.
JOB DUTIES/R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Holds management responsibility to ensure a safe production environment that operates within all applicable regulatory compliance requirements, including environmental operating permits, NERC reliability standards, Sarbannes-Oxley processes, RTO requirements, and company policies. Frequently monitors operations for safety and efficiency; periodically conducts field inspections of plants, stations, or substations to ensure normal and safe operating conditions. Identifies abnormalities with power production equipment or processes.
- Holds complete ownership for all the operations and performance of the power plant. Sets organizational priorities and allocates resources to meet plant and business objectives. Adapts plans and adjusts priorities as needed to meet the service and/or operational challenges of the plant. Identifies and resolves complex technical, operational and organizational problems. Monitors the operating status of plants by establishing and reporting of plant and business key performance indicators, and taking or assigning action to close performance gaps.
- Leads and directs the work of plant staff and coordinates with the business unit support group personnel as needed. Oversees staff to provide operations support functions, such as engineering and technical support, maintenance, work planning and execution, regulatory compliance, and administrative support. Manages operations and maintenance employees in the production of power and ensures they are properly trained. Develops and maintains strong relationships with internal and external interfaces and key strategic alliance partners.
- Ensures that a strong performance-driven culture is established and maintained at the plant with frequent engagement with employees at all levels. Guides employees and instills accountability to adhere to and actively support operations code of conduct, procedure usage, and other standards necessary to reduce errors and foster a culture of continuous improvement.
- Responsible for ensuring plant is prepared and capable to meet system load requirements; ensures adequate production levels. Works with system planning organization to maximize plant production.
- Prepares and manages plant budgets. Implements processes to ensure maximum asset utilization. Continuously monitors performance results against financial and operational goals. Ensures plant resources achieve annual goals and objectives for Power Generation business segment. Evaluates and champions gap closure actions that are consistent with the company's overall business strategy.

How do you become a product operations manager in Louisiana?
Most product operations manager roles in Louisiana require a bachelor's degree in business administration, industrial engineering, or a related field, though some employers accept equivalent work experience. Louisiana does not require a state-issued license for this role. Hiring managers in the state typically look for candidates who have worked within energy, healthcare, or logistics operations, reflecting the dominant industries here. Building experience in project coordination, process documentation, or product analytics is the most practical path into the role.

How can I get hired as a product operations manager in Louisiana with little or no experience?
The most realistic entry path is moving laterally from a coordinator, analyst, or associate program manager role within a Louisiana employer that already knows your work. Large Louisiana health systems such as Ochsner Health and LCMC Health, along with energy firms like Entergy, hire operations analysts and project coordinators who transition into product operations over time. Building a portfolio of process maps, sprint documentation, or cross-functional project outcomes, and earning a CAPM or similar entry-level project management credential, strengthens a candidate's case considerably.
